Increasing subsequences, matrix loci and Viennot shadows
Let ${\mathbf {x}}_{n \times n}$ be an $n \times n$ matrix of variables, and let ${\mathbb {F}}[{\mathbf {x}}_{n \times n}]$ be the polynomial ring in these variables over a field ${\mathbb {F}}$ . We study the ideal $I_n \subseteq {\mathbb {F}}[{\mathbf {x}}_{n \times...
